FYI!!!!
There are no longer JI-II JO's. These have been replaced with Eastern Alpine Championships (still a FIS level event). T/S quota= 5.
JI-II finals are the same . T/S quota =19.

NEW EVENT!!!!! JII Eastern championships ,(USSA event) T/S quota=9.
this race series is a qualifier for JII Nationals.

At present the tri-state qualifing process is the same as it was last year.

Liz,
USSA has created a National Jr II event. I will try and inform you with as much information as I have to date. The Tri-State Fall meeting will finalize any procedures on qualifications, rules and quotas. Three new events will be offered. They are as follows;
1. Jr II Eastern Championships – For JII Competitors Only
Burke, VT February 24-27 ( 2SG, GS, SL). An Eastern quota will be named from this event to Jr II Nationals to be held at Whiteface March 5-11 (GS, SL, SG, DH).
A. Tri-State quota is a total of 9. Named athletes will need to make a choice to either participate at the new Jr II Eastern Championships or decline the spot and continue in the qualifying procedure to the newly created USSA Eastern Alpine Championships (Formally the Junior Olympics see description below).
B. Athletes must commit to or decline their spot to Jr II Eastern Championships at the time of Team selection. If the athlete decides to decline they can continue on to to USSA Eastern Alpine Championship (If they qualify) or Eastern Jr I-II Finals
C. An Eastern quota will be named from this event to Jr II Nationals to be held at Whiteface March 5-11 (GS, SL, SG, DH).
D.
2. Jr I,II, Sr Eastern Alpine Championships – (Formally the Junior Olympics)
March 3-7 at Okemo (DH,SG, GS, SL)
A. Tri-State quota is 5.Open to seniors, JI and JII competitors. Additional Eastern spots will be named from current FIS points and Eastern Cup Scoring. The total field size is 161.
3. Eastern Jr I-II Finals
Sugarloaf, Me. March 8-14 (DH,SG, GS, SL)
The traditional Eastern Jr I-II Finals remains intact. Open to JI and JII competitors. Quota is 19.
Qualification to Jr I-II Eastern Finals, Eastern JII championships and the Eastern Alpine Championships in Tri-State will be based on the same points system as last year. The point system is under review and might be subject to change at the fall meeting.
